Let's call the measure of the first angle "x". Then, the equation can be written as:
x = 3y - 8
Since the angles are supplementary, their measures add up to 180 degrees, so:
x + y = 180
We can substitute the first equation into the second equation to solve for y:
3y - 8 + y = 180
4y = 188
y = 47
Now that we know the measure of y, we can substitute it back into the first equation to find x:
x = 3(47) - 8 = 133
So the measure of the larger angle is 133 degrees.
